El Salvador Mission Work

In the summer of 2008 and 2009, St. Peter’s has been globally involved by sending our missioners to El Salvador under the direction of Foundation Cristosal, an organization that supports the ministry of Episcopal Diocese of El Salvador. While there, our missioners help in rebuilding a church facility that had been in disrepair since the beginning of the country’s civil war in the village of Sitio de Los Nejapas. Padre David of San Miguel Church in Quezaltepeque overseas our development efforts.

Millennium Development Goals


St. Peter’s participates in a global enterprise known as Millennium Development Goals (MDGs), initiated by the leaders from the United States and 190 other nations and endorsed by the Episcopal Church, by earmarking 1% of its budget. MDGs seek to reduce extreme global poverty in half by year 2015 by achieving the following goals:
  1. Eradicate Extreme Poverty and Hunger
  2. Achieve Universal Primary Education for Children
  3. Promote Gender Equality and Empower Women
  4. Reduce Child Mortality
  5. Improve Maternal Health
  6. Combat HIV/AIDS, Malaria and Other Diseases
  7. Ensure Environment Sustainability
  8. Create a Global Partnership for Development
As Foundation Cristosal’s efforts in El Salvador cover most of the goals of Millennium Development initiative, we distribute our funds for the development efforts in El Salvador through Foundation Cristosal. Half of what we contribute goes towards achieving Universal Primary Education for children and the other half goes to support an agricultural school in eastern El Salvador called Hasta la Cosecha. Through our annual mission trips, involvement with the people of El Salvador, and through our participation in the MDGs, we hope to “develop a global partnership for development.”
